编程是要什么软件好学一点
-
编程是一种需要掌握技能和使用特定软件的活动。选择适合初学者的编程软件可以帮助您更轻松地学习编程知识。以下是几个适合初学者的编程软件推荐:
-
Scratch:Scratch是由麻省理工学院设计的图形化编程语言,适合儿童和初学者。它使用图块式编程,可以通过拖拽和组合图块来创建程序。Scratch提供了丰富的教程和社区支持,使学习编程变得更加有趣和互动。
-
Python:Python是一种易于学习和使用的编程语言,适合初学者。它有简洁的语法和丰富的库,可以用于各种不同的应用,包括Web开发、数据分析、人工智能等。Python有许多开发环境可以选择,如PyCharm、Anaconda和Jupyter Notebook等。
-
HTML/CSS:HTML和CSS是构建网页的基本语言,对于有兴趣学习Web开发的初学者来说是很好的入门选择。HTML用于定义网页的结构和内容,CSS用于控制网页的样式和布局。您可以使用任何文本编辑器,如Sublime Text、Visual Studio Code等来编写HTML和CSS代码。
-
Arduino:Arduino是一种开源硬件平台,可以用于制作各种物联网设备和电子项目。它使用C/C++语言编程,但有许多简化的库和示例代码可供初学者使用。Arduino IDE是Arduino官方提供的集成开发环境,可以用于编写、编译和上传代码到Arduino板上。
除了上述软件,还有许多其他适合初学者的编程软件可供选择,如Java的Eclipse、JavaScript的Visual Studio Code、Swift的Xcode等。选择适合自己的编程软件,可以根据个人的兴趣、学习目标和项目需求来决定。重要的是坚持学习,不断实践和探索,才能真正掌握编程技能。
1年前 -
-
如果你想学习编程,有几种常用的软件工具可以帮助你入门。以下是五个易于学习和使用的编程软件:
-
Python
Python是一种简单易学的编程语言,广泛用于各种应用领域。它有一个直观的语法,适合初学者入门。Python的官方解释器可以免费下载并安装在任何操作系统上,同时也有许多开发环境可供选择,如PyCharm、Visual Studio Code等。通过Python,你可以学习编程的基础概念和算法,并且可以用它来进行数据分析、Web开发、人工智能等各种应用。 -
Scratch
Scratch是一种图形化编程语言,专门为初学者设计。通过简单拖拽和组合代码块,你可以创建动画、游戏和交互式媒体等项目。Scratch具有友好的用户界面和可视化编程环境,不需要输入复杂的代码,适合儿童和初学者学习编程的基础概念。 -
HTML/CSS
如果你对网页设计和开发感兴趣,学习HTML和CSS是一个不错的选择。HTML是用来定义网页结构的标记语言,CSS用于控制网页的样式和布局。你可以使用任何文本编辑器,如Notepad++、Sublime Text等来编写HTML和CSS代码,并通过浏览器预览结果。学习HTML和CSS可以让你创建自己的网页,并为网页设计和前端开发打下基础。 -
JavaScript
JavaScript是一种广泛用于前端开发的脚本语言,用于给网页增加动态效果和交互性。学习JavaScript可以让你掌握网页开发中的核心技术,并且可以通过Node.js来进行后端开发。你可以使用任何文本编辑器编写JavaScript代码,并在浏览器中运行和调试。此外,还有一些流行的集成开发环境如Visual Studio Code等,可以帮助你更方便地编写和调试JavaScript代码。 -
Java
Java是一种跨平台的面向对象编程语言,广泛应用于企业级开发和Android应用程序开发。虽然Java相对于Python和Scratch来说稍微复杂一些,但它是一种非常强大和通用的语言。你可以使用Java开发桌面应用程序、Web应用程序、移动应用程序等。学习Java可以帮助你理解面向对象编程的概念,并为进一步学习其他编程语言打下坚实的基础。
以上是五个比较容易入门的编程软件,每个软件都有其特点和适用场景。选择适合自己的编程软件,根据个人兴趣和学习目标,开始你的编程之旅吧!
1年前 -
-
编程是一门创造性的活动,需要掌握一定的技能和工具才能进行学习和实践。下面是一些适合初学者的编程软件,可以帮助你更轻松地开始学习编程。
-
Python IDLE:Python IDLE是Python官方提供的集成开发环境(IDE),适用于初学者。它具有简单易用的界面和基本的代码编辑、运行和调试功能。Python是一种易于学习的编程语言,适合初学者入门。
-
Scratch:Scratch是一款面向初学者的可视化编程软件,由麻省理工学院开发。它采用拖拽式的编程方式,使用图形化的积木块来构建程序,适合儿童和编程初学者。Scratch有一个活跃的社区,可以分享和学习其他人的项目。
-
Codecademy:Codecademy是一个在线学习平台,提供各种编程语言的课程和项目。它提供了一个交互式的编码环境,让你可以直接在网页上编写和运行代码。Codecademy还提供了丰富的练习和项目,帮助你巩固所学知识。
-
Visual Studio Code:Visual Studio Code是一个免费的开源代码编辑器,支持多种编程语言。它有丰富的插件生态系统,可以扩展其功能,适用于不同的编程任务。Visual Studio Code具有智能代码补全、调试功能等,可以提高编程效率。
-
Arduino IDE:如果你对物联网或电子项目感兴趣,Arduino IDE是一个不错的选择。Arduino是一种开源的硬件平台,用于构建各种交互式项目。Arduino IDE提供了一个简单的编码环境,可以编写和上传代码到Arduino板。
-
Unity:Unity是一款专业的游戏开发引擎,适合有一定编程基础的人学习。它支持多种编程语言,如C#和JavaScript。Unity提供了一个可视化的编辑器,可以创建各种类型的游戏和应用程序。
总之,选择适合自己的编程软件取决于你的兴趣和目标。以上软件只是一些常用的选择,你可以根据自己的需求进行选择。无论选择哪个软件,重要的是坚持学习和实践,不断提升自己的编程技能。
1年前 -